High school football playoffs: CIF Southern Section Division 1 headlines top 10 toughest postseason brackets

By Zack Poff Nov 9, 2023, 10:58am

California, Georgia, Ohio, Texas each have two brackets featured.

It's the best time of the year in high school football as every state is now in playoffs or has crowned champions. We are zoning in on the top 10 postseason brackets in the country and Southern California's CIF Southern Section Division 1 bracket headlines the list.

There are four MaxPreps Top 25 teams in the eight-team field led by No. 3 St. John Bosco (Bellflower) and No. 5 Mater Dei (Santa Ana). The bracket also features No. 19 Centennial (Corona) and No. 21 Sierra Canyon (Chatsworth).

Checking in at No. 2 on the list is the largest classification in Georgia. The AAAAAAA bracket has more teams ranked in the MaxPreps Top 25 with five than any other in high school football. The five nationally ranked teams include No. 8 Mill Creek (Hoschton), No. 11 Colquitt County (Moultrie), No. 12 Walton (Marietta), No. 16 Buford and No. 17 Carrollton.

Texas takes home the next two spots in the UIL 6A Division 1 and Division 2 brackets. No. 6 North Shore (Houston) and No. 15 Duncanville headline the 64-team field in Division 1. These two have met in four of the last five state title games. North Shore won it in 2018, 2019 and 2021, while the Panthers are the defending state champs.



No. 7 DeSoto is the lone MaxPreps Top 25 team in the 6A D2 field and it features four teams in our expanded top 100.

Florida's 2M bracket rounds out the top five. It has two MaxPreps Top 25 teams in it — No. 13 Norland (Miami) and No. 20 American Heritage (Plantation). It also has the four-time defending state champs, Central (Miami). They are the first team out of the MaxPreps Top 25 at No. 26.

Ohio's Division I and II brackets along with Arizona's Open Division, the CIF Southern Section Division 2 field, and Louisiana's Division 1 Select field round out the list.
